Keywords That Will Power Your PPC Campaign

The Secret to a Good PPC Campaign is choosing the best group of keywords. It’s important to be certain that you’ve managed to find high standard keywords and phrases to get the best outcomes. Develop a comprehensive list and find out all of the options that are open to you. Begin with a current popular keyword — for example the word “credit”, many people search for this word online, but it is difficult to rank well with this word because it’s used for lots of other advertisements. So how can you increase your options? Change your approach and include related terms.

Consider how searchers could be using the keyword in question. Someone searching for the word “credit” may be attempting to find out ways to get a credit report, ways to improve personal credit which lenders will give loans to people with poor credit or ways to consolidate credit card debit. When you’ve gotten a range of concepts that the word could be related to, then try to condense them a bit.

These longer concepts become a series of terms that people search for, all related to your basic keyword. “Credit” becomes “free credit report”, “get better credit”, “bad credit loan” and “consolidate credit cards”. There are lots of other options, and these words are just a little different from the original keyword. You can keep expanding from there.

Stick to the basic concept, but expand your horizons. There are plenty of credit related search terms, like the names of the individual bureaus, consolidation companies and more. Mix them in as part of your first list, and you’ll have created a number of different keyword groups from just one starting term. Go on to create ad groups made up entirely of consolidation companies, for instance.

Add an extension like .org, .net, or .com to the search term, or consider a country you’re trying to target. The domain doesn’t have to exist, it’s just a specific term the search engine will consider. Some people still use the country index and you’ll be able to target them with your ads and increase your chances of a sale.

Some people think that very general words are a winning formula, but it actually works in the opposite way. The competition for these types of words is huge. Try to stay with related terms and rephrased keyword combination. You can turn “free credit report” into “credit report free” while it seems like the same thins each phrase will reach a different audience. Consider what your target market is going to type into their search engine.

It’s not all there is to a good PPC campaign, but a good keyword list is the foundation of one that works. Explore all your options and pick the right words, then track their progress to be sure your campaign is a successful one.

Why Do Pay Per Click Advertising

There are several points that make pay per click advertising a vital part of your business. Here are five.

Your first objective when you begin a pay per click advertising campaign is to get the edge on your competition. Pay per click works on the concept of how the average person searches. Despite the fact that many results can come up, only the first few are looked at by the searcher. Pay per click advertising will ensure that your ad will be among these first results. This will enable searchers to notice your ads and hopefully click through and buy your products. In this way you will get ahead of your competition.

The related advantage which pay per click advertising offers you is that your entry will appear at the head of the list right from the time you enlist the advertising campaign, which means that you do not have to waste precious time waiting for your website to grow in popularity, traffic, or business. The flip side to this is that, as you shall have to bid for it, the assured foremost entry against a search may become very expensive.

A third reason is that pay per view advertising increases the visibility and prominence of your website. For instance, against each search using Google, the pay per click advertising related to the search item appears additionally along the right hand space of the monitor. This makes your website stand out and enhances the chances of the searcher following your link.

Niche markets are especially suitable for pay per click advertising. This is because your campaigns are customized when you choose highly targeted keywords. In this way you will be able to draw many targeted visitors to your website. This is because pay per click advertising is the quickest way to find your niche market buyers. Your website will prosper as it rapidly ascends to the top of the search engines. There is no faster way to get targeted visitors to your website.

Lastly pay per click advertising can save you money. This is because only those who actually click through on your ad need to be paid for. With other forms of advertising you just pay for the ad regardless of whether the readers take action. However with pay per click you just pay for visitors who take action and this can save you a lot of money.

But a parting word of advice. Unless you have a huge advertising budget or are otherwise absolutely certain of the returns that your advertisement investment fetches you, it is best that you try to optimize your pay per click investment and get the best value for your money. We therefore recommend that you should try and ensure that your advertisement entry appears between the third and eighth spots on the first page of the search results. This allows you to save money by not having to pay exorbitantly for the first two spots, but without at the same time having to compromise on the actual effectiveness and pull of your advertisement. If you can ensure this, pay per click advertisement shall definitely work for your business and you shall reap rich dividends.
